Rittenhouse Celebrates Residents and Families with 2014 Cookout and Picnic

On Saturday July 19th, the residents of Rittenhouse Senior Living in Valparaiso had their yearly cookout and picnic to celebrate the summer. Residents invited their families and friends to come enjoy some grilled food, live entertainment and antique cars at the facility. The party was a 50’s 60’s Sock Hop theme and approximately 300 residents and families attended.

Activities Director of Rittenhouse, Silvia Stockmen, coordinated the event in conjunction with Chef JoAnn Quade and other staff members to ensure that the residents and their families were well fed and entertained. The Winamac Old Auto Club also attended with 17 antique cars on display for the families to enjoy. A DJ as well as live musical entertainment by Paul and Kim Vogrin were available for the guests and the Bonner Center Dancers made an appearance and danced. Children’s activities included a piñata, sidewalk chalk, bubbles and a root beer float stand.

“It was just awesome to see everyone enjoying themselves,” said Stockman, “everything just came together perfectly and I would like to thank everyone who showed up and joined us for this special day. Looking forward to next year’s picnic, but it is going to be hard to top this year!”

Executive Director of Rittenhouse Valparaiso, Debby Atsas, feels it is important to hold a yearly event that celebrates the residents and includes their family and friends. “We made sure there was something for everyone,” said Atsas, “This is the residents’ home and just like entertaining for a family cookout, we made sure we covered the essentials so everyone enjoyed themselves. The families really look forward to this every year. It’s a nice tradition and a great way to give back to the residents.”

Rittenhouse Senior Living of Valparaiso will celebrate its five year anniversary this October, but the company itself has been around since 2007. The company owns and operates Independent, Assisted Living and Memory Care Communities in Indiana, Alabama and Pennsylvania.
